Operating system: Linux 2.2.5-15
PHP version: 4.0.5
PHP Bug Type: Apache related
Bug description: child pid xxxx exit signal Segmentation fault (11)
I hope I am on the right path to report this.
If you need more information, please let me know.
I installed 4.0.5 and had problems with three scripts, that run without any problem before. (Other scripts still ran).
Checking the apache error file, I noticed the different exit Segmentation faults.
Recompiling back to the previous version of PHP 4.0.4pl1 solved all the problems.
